Output e76f31c38549594a114b54e162cb8f84df563aee99a540e6889c0b52a9fdeb11:1

value
6837906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296ab9c0f663e90c7b671afd7a785b041d7b605b OP_EQUAL
address
MBg9niiDzKaCZgSzoGRmKkPp3RR11Gew86
transaction
e76f31c38549594a114b54e162cb8f84df563aee99a540e6889c0b52a9fdeb11
spent
true